We are two unique single-gender camps on two lakes, united as one community. For more than 110 years, YMCA Hayo-Went-Ha Camps has carried forward a rich tradition shaped by generations of loyal alumni.
Our program blends backcountry wilderness adventure with classic residential camp life. Campers learn responsibility, teamwork, leadership, and the values that help young people grow into caring, capable adults. We keep camp unplugged, with no cell phones or social media, so campers can focus on face-to-face friendships and real communication.
Each year we raise roughly $300,000 in camperships because we believe every child who wants to come to camp should be able to attend, regardless of a family’s ability to pay. Season after season, campers leave empowered, confident, and deeply connected to others and the outdoors.
